【发布时间】:2016-12-28 01:40:55
【问题描述】:
美好的一天,我只是想问一下我在 laravel 中的数据库设计方法是否还可以。我在这方面有点新手
用户注册到站点后。他的主要信息将存储在
users表中,该表主要包含他的name、email、password、role_id和一个布尔值confirmed列。确认列默认设置为零,这意味着管理员必须批准该应用程序才能将其更改为 1。在管理员根据他/她的角色批准该特定用户的申请后。我的方法是根据他/她的角色查询
users表,例如 Select * from users where role_id = '2' and confirm = '0' 这意味着查询表中那些角色 ID 为 2 并且是尚未确认。管理员确认用户后。在他单击“批准”选项后。特定用户现在可以登录该站点并可以在
user_details表中输入他/她的详细信息。
我只是想问一下这是否正确。或者,如果您有任何我可以使用的 ER 图来寻求帮助。
【问题讨论】: